Dorothy L. Windon 71 of Wintersville, Ohio died Saturday, March 13, 2004 at Trinity West. She was born in Piney Fork, Ohio on June 16, 1932 a daughter of the late John and Gertrude Schrickel Barker. Dorothy was Methodist by faith and a member of Dip & Dive Square Dance Club. She was preceded in death by one son Ricky Lee Windon on January 1, 2001; two brothers John Barker and Ronald W. Barker, Sr.; and one sister Betty Shambaugh. Dorothy is survived by her husband John L. Windon, Sr. whom she married on August 4, 1951; children Gary (Pat) Windon of Mingo Junction, Terri Windon of Westerville, Ohio, John L. (Lisa) Windon, Jr. of Wintersville, Lori (Kurt) Kale of Jewett, Ohio and Michael (Kathy) Windon of Fayetteville, GA; daughter-in-law Jean (late Ricky Lee) Windon of Mingo; brother Chuck (Jean) Barker of Steubenville; sister Donna (Blaine) Rennie of Richmond, Ohio; twelve grandchildren Erin Windon Walline, Brianna Windon, Robyn Vittek, Kelly Walker, Steven Windon, Penny Jo Long, Jason Windon, Brett Windon, Kailee Jo Windon, Kassandra Kale, Vance Windon and Leanne Windon; and one great grandson Austin Long. Friends may call at Dunlope-Shorac Funeral Home, 215 Fernwood Road, Wintersville on Tuesday 2-4 & 7-9 p.m., where services will be held at 12:30 p.m. Wednesday with Rev. Preston Van Deursen officiating. Burial at Fort Steuben.
